Responsibilities
- Room patients and prepare them for provider visits
- Perform administrative duties, including scheduling, documentation, and patient communication
- Maintain cleanliness and organization of exam rooms and clinical areas
- Stock exam rooms and clinical supplies
- Assure completeness of ordered procedures and treatments, ensure smooth patient flow
- Perform general lab work
- Instruct patients concerning procedures, treatments, and needs
- Ensure medical orders and referrals are carried out accurately and in a timely manner
- Perform registration and scheduling activities per organizational and departmental procedures
- Maintain EMR files and perform general front office functions as needed
- May perform computerized physician order entry, only if directed by assigned physician
- Precept current Medical Assistant team members or Medical Assistant Externs as requested by leadership
Requirements
- AHA Basic Life Support for healthcare workers certification required
- Other advanced life support certifications may be required per unit/department specialty according to patient care policies
- High school diploma or equivalent required
- Graduation from a Medical Assistant program preferred
- Current certification in medical assisting required from one of the following:
- America Association of Medical Assistants (CMA)
- American Medical Technologists (RMA)
- National Health Career Association (CCMA)
- National Center for Competency Testing (NCMA)
- American Medical Certification Association (CMAC)
- Knowledge of OSHA, CLIA, and ADA required
- Knowledge of ICD-10 and CPT coding required
- TB validated (to administer or read) or validation obtained within 6 months of hire preferred
- Knowledge of Business Unit Quality Programs, Meaningful Use, and Standard Work Programs and concepts within 6 months of hire
- Knowledge of standard laboratory and medical procedures
- Knowledge of insurance plans and third-party payers
- Ability to master standard clinical competencies per current Clinical policy, Point of Care, and Skills Competency checklists
- Requires basic math and accurate data collection and entry skills
